Like all doors, bi fold doors will see some wear and tear over time. Some of the wear and tear could result from an unsuitable setup or weather conditions, but most of the issues that are encountered by bi fold doors can be solved with a few simple fixes.

The most common problem for bi fold doors is when it starts to sag or scrape against the floor. This can be caused by adding carpet to the floor or changing flooring materials. It could be caused by faulty hardware, or broken pivot pins. Three basic adjustments can be made to fix this problem.

Begin by loosening the screw that holds the top of the pivot bolt slightly using a wrench. Then use a screwdriver to tighten it up. This will allow you to re-align your door. It is possible repeat this procedure several times to ensure that the door is in the correct alignment.

Make sure the anchors/pivots at the top and bottom haven't split. If they're cracked, you can glue them to each other. However, this is likely to be a temporary solution. If the crack is significant, you will need to replace the pivot pin.

You can also remove the pin that is broken, and then find a machine shop to make the new cap using Delrin or Nylon. Then, you'll be able to attach it to the pin made of metal that is already there. You will have to save the damaged cover to hand over to the machine shop so that they can duplicate the outside dimensions of the cap.

In the end, you can grease the pivot bolt using grease. This will allow it to move more smoothly, however, you must ensure that the grease doesn't contain Molybdenum Di Sulfide, as this could cause corrosion in areas of high stress.

A squeaking sound coming from the bifold doors is a frequent issue that can be found in the doors. This could indicate that you need to clean or lubricate the tracks. It could also indicate that something has become stuck in the track and needs to be removed. It is also possible to lubricate your hinges because they may dry up.

If your bifold doors begin making a squeaking sound the first thing you can do is stop using them and check what's causing the issue. It is essential not to push the bifold door open. This could cause more damage and can increase repair costs. It is recommended that an expert visit and examine the issue is the next step.

You may also hear squeaking if you have sand, dirt or gravel on the tracks. This could cause the roller to pop out. It is recommended to check the tracks at least once a month to ensure they are free of debris and sand. You can make use of compressed air to remove any hard-to-remove debris.
